Recap: Summit Tahoma Tigers vs. Latino College Preparatory Academy Golden Eagles

The Summit Tahoma Tigers's game last Saturday was a tough lo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Tuesday. They strolled past Latino College Preparatory Academy with points to spare, taking the game 47-32. For Summit Tahoma, this counts as revenge for the 61-25 loss Latino College Preparatory Academy walked away with the last time they faced one another back in January of 2023.

Summit Tahoma's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Michael Salazar led the charge by scoring 19 points. David Pilling was another key contributor, scoring 12 points.

Summit Tahoma now has a winning record of 2-1. As for Latino College Preparatory Academy,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 3-3.

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Summit Tahoma's homestand continues as they prepare to take on KIPP Navigate College Prep at 6:00 p.m. on January 19th. Latino College Preparatory Academy will take on Cindy Avitia at 7:15 p.m. on Thursday. Cindy Avitia is coming into the match on a four-game losing streak.
